Final Conclusions

In conclusion, the integration of artificial intelligence (AI) into organizational processes has fundamentally transformed the way businesses operate, leading to significant enhancements in efficiency and productivity. By automating repetitive tasks and providing intelligent insights, AI empowers organizations to allocate resources more effectively and make data-driven decisions that drive growth. Furthermore, the ability to analyze vast amounts of data in real-time not only streamlines workflows but also fosters innovation, allowing companies to remain competitive in an increasingly dynamic market landscape.

As organizations continue to embrace AI technologies, it is essential for them to remain mindful of the ethical implications and workforce dynamics that arise from such transformations. While AI serves as a catalyst for enhanced operational efficiency, its implementation should be approached with careful consideration of employee roles and job satisfaction. By fostering a collaborative environment where AI and human capabilities complement one another, organizations can achieve a sustainable balance that maximizes efficiency while promoting a thriving workplace culture. Ultimately, the successful integration of AI into organizational frameworks will redefine the future of work, creating opportunities that were previously unimaginable.
